### Item 14 — Loyalty ledger reconciliation

Verify that the Pointsmith ledger balances against the Emberline rewards export for the last three closed periods. Flag any negative accrual rows; they should never occur post-migration. Check that reversal entries carry a matching original transaction. Do not modify ledger rows directly. Record findings in the audit log, then obtain sign-off from the owner named below.

approver of yajef-fajef = Oliwyn Silion Kasok Kasox

**Ticket TRK-4412: Intermittent connection failures on finish-line readers**

For anyone new to the StridePulse stack: the chip readers at each timing mat buffer split times locally, then flush to the central results database every five seconds. Since Saturday's Harborlight Marathon, readers 3 and 5 have been dropping their database sessions mid-flush, leaving gaps in the splits table. Before digging into logs, verify the readers are using the current credentials. The correct connection string for the results database is the following.

primary connection of yagep-kahip = redis://giliel_svc:zYiKsLL2PLpfPL@db-348f.xolmarsys.corp:5432/fenwyn

**Maintainer Onboarding: Gridwright Crossword Generator**

Gridwright builds symmetric grids first, then fills them against the Lexivane word list using beam search with backtracking. Maintainers should know that fill quality degrades sharply if the themed entries exceed six slots, so the validator rejects those early. Tests live under `fill/`, and the scoring weights are versioned — never edit them in place. Access to the encrypted weights archive requires the recovery passphrase noted directly below.

unlock words, bagag-yafof: praax-casox-ralir

# Heads up, on-call: this is the env file for the Marrowfen exam-proctoring
# queue workers. If candidates report "session stuck at verification," it's
# almost always a worker that lost its broker connection — bounce it with
# `fenctl restart proctor-q` before digging deeper. Queue depth over 500 pages
# you automatically, so don't panic at the first alert. Don't touch the retry
# knobs without pinging the Oakhollow team first. The workers can't even
# connect to the broker without the credential on the next line:

env line for fafof-fahag: LEDGER_TOKEN5=f8790